The Evolution of Jake Paul
Initially rising to fame on the now-defunct social media platform Vine, Jake Paul quickly transitioned to YouTube, where he amassed an impressive following due to his often outrageous and controversial content. Known for his prank videos and extravagant lifestyle, he frequently found himself in the spotlight for both positive and negative reasons. In 2020, Paul ventured into the world of boxing, a move that further ignited public interest and debate regarding his skills and intentions.
Boxing Career and Milestones
Jake made his boxing debut on January 30, 2020, defeating YouTuber AnEsonGib in a TKO victory. This win established him as a serious contender in the sport, and he quickly sought higher-profile opponents. His subsequent matches against former MMA champions like Ben Askren and Tyron Woodley garnered substantial attention and pay-per-view sales. Controversies Surrounding Jake Paul
Despite his successes, Jake Paul remains a polarizing figure. His antics have often attracted criticism—such as the infamous incident involving fire in a California neighborhood and multiple run-ins with the law. Additionally, his brazen confidence and trash talk in the lead-up to fights have sparked both admiration and disdain. Jake’s approach has led many to question the integrity of boxing; however, some argue that he is just revitalizing interest in the sport.
